School Overview

Hamburg Middle School is a public school located in Hamburg, Arkansas. It is a school in Hamburg School District district.

According to the Arkansas state assessment result, 44% of students are proficient in Math learning and 39%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 373 students through grade 6 to 8. The students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1 where a total of 30 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 30 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Hamburg Middle School and the students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1. All teachers are certified. 86.7%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.

Social/Economic Characteristics

A total of 3,319 households is located in Hamburg School District, AR area. The average home price is $71,000 and the average rent cost is $601. The unemployment rate is 7.60% and the average household income is $46,002.
